Invest in Your Future with Savocchi Franchise

SAVOCCHI Franchise Opportunity

Are you seeking to build a business full of unlimited growth opportunities and ongoing support? Are you looking for a franchise opportunity that is an essential business and is proven to be recession resistant? Savocchi Franchise is the opportunity you’ve been waiting for!

savocchi franchise

Our Story Proves Our Success

Savocchi Franchise is a leading glass and glazing company that has been serving customers since 1949. From our humble beginnings as a windshield replacement company in Winnetka, Illinois, we have grown to become a trusted source for a wide range of glass products and services.

At Savocchi, we take pride in our ability to meet the intricate demands of our customers. Representing multiple manufacturers, our sales and service teams are able to offer a one-stop-shop for any glazing needs in the building industry.

Over the years, Savocchi has seen its share of ups and downs, including the post-Great Depression era, 1970s stagflation, 1981 recession, 9/11 attacks, 2008 financial crisis, and multiple oil and energy crises. Despite these challenges, we have weathered them all and emerged even stronger.

Today, owner Russell Andreev is leading Savocchi to be the top glazing company in the nation. With his skills and experience, he has developed an incredible system that allows entrepreneurs to shape their own business and meet the local market demands.

If you’re looking to own a  trusted source for glass, windows and doors, look no further than Savocchi Franchise. With over 70 years of experience, we have the expertise and resources to help you grow. Contact us today to learn more about this opportunity.

Make Your Future Bulletproof!

Why is Savocchi worth investing in? Because we understand what it takes to be successful within this industry and are one of the longest standing glass and glazing companies around! You aren’t starting this from scratch. We are giving you procedures, processes, software, customer service techniques, and marketing that are all proven to work! Every building has glass – we are essential, recession resistant, necessary — meaning the growth opportunity for your Savocchi franchise is limitless!

Why Invest in Savocchi?

When you start your franchise with Savocchi, you are gaining a team of experts to give you tips, guidance, and troubleshooting advice every step of the way. As a franchisee, you benefit from…


Our specialist will contact you and discuss your requirements.

Call Us Now